码迷,mamicode.com
首页 >  
搜索关键字:抽象方法    ( 2552个结果
Java8 新特性
接口的默认方法 Lambda表达式 以前排列字符串 Java 8中 函数式接口 “函数式接口”是指仅仅只包含一个抽象方法,但是可以有多个非抽象方法(也就是默认方法)的接口。 方法和构造函数引用 前一节中的代码还可以通过静态方法引用来表示: Java 8允许通过 “ :: ” 关键字传递方法或构造函数 ...
分类:编程语言   时间:2020-03-13 17:07:41    阅读次数:60
lambda表达式学习
Lambda表达式(jdk8) 1、一个接口如果只有一个抽象方法,那么它就是一个函数式接口。 2、对于函数式接口,我们可以通过lambda表达式来创建该接口的对象。 好处: 1、避免匿名内部类定义过多 2、可以让你的代码看起来简洁 3、去掉一堆没有意义的代码,只留下核心的逻辑。 格式: ()->{代 ...
分类:其他好文   时间:2020-03-12 14:20:33    阅读次数:47
Java 抽象类 抽象方法 使用说明
本文主要介绍什么是抽象类、什么是抽象方法,以及什么时候使用他们,最后还介绍了抽象方法与设计模式,并都附有完整的实例源码和源码详细说明。 ...
分类:编程语言   时间:2020-03-11 10:45:34    阅读次数:61
多态及实现方式
什么是多态? 一句话解释多态:多态就是一个事物多种形态,就是同一符号或者名字在不同情况下具有不同解释的现象。 多态是同一个行为具有多个不同表现形式或形态的能力。 多态就是同一个接口,使用不同的实例而执行不同操作,如图所示: 多态性是对象多种表现形式的体现。比如下面这个例子: 现实中,比如我们按下 F ...
分类:其他好文   时间:2020-03-11 01:18:38    阅读次数:45
Java-22,抽象类
用abstract关键字来修饰一个类时,这个类叫做抽象类;用abstract来修饰一个方法时,该方法叫做抽象方法。 含有抽象方法的类必须被声明为抽象类,抽象类必须被继承,抽象方法必须被重写。 抽象类不能被实例化 抽象方法只需声明,而不需实现。 package com.nyist; abstract ...
分类:编程语言   时间:2020-03-09 22:32:21    阅读次数:59
今夜我懂了Lambda表达式_解析
现在时间午夜十一点~ 此刻的我血脉喷张,异常兴奋:因为专注得学习了一把java,在深入集合的过程中发现好多套路配合Lambda表达式真的是搜椅子,so开了个分支,决定从“只认得”,变为“我懂得” start: 先上一盘代码,对应来解析: 解析: 1. 首先此例将Lambda表达式作为实现了接口的实例 ...
分类:其他好文   时间:2020-03-08 23:26:35    阅读次数:118
Java8 新特性3——方法引用与构造器引用
当要传递给Lambda体的操作,已经有实现的方法了,可以使用方法引用!(实现抽象方法的参数列表,必须与方法引用方法的参数列表保持一致! ...
分类:编程语言   时间:2020-03-08 12:29:22    阅读次数:63
java的静态代理和2种动态代理(未完,待续)
package com.liubingfei.test.proxy.staticproxy; /** * @author LiuBingFei * @desc 接口,定义抽象方法:卖房子,出租房子。 * @date 2020/3/5 22:09 * @return */ public interfa ...
分类:编程语言   时间:2020-03-06 01:34:02    阅读次数:97
5.5 抽象类
一、为什么要使用抽象类、抽象方法 当编写一个类时,常常会定义一些类用于描述该类的行为方式,那么这些方法都有具体的方法体。但在某些情况下,某个父类只知道其子类应该包含什么样的方法,但无法准确知道这些子类的如何实现这些方法。 例如:定义了一个Shape类,这个类应该提供一个计算周长的方法calPerim ...
分类:其他好文   时间:2020-03-04 21:10:04    阅读次数:72
Java中的接口
接口 1.1 概述 接口是Java中的 引用类型 ,是方法的集合 类的内部封装了成员变量、构造方法和成员方法 接口的内部主要的就是 封装了方法 ,包含 1. 抽象方法(JDK 7及以前) 2. 默认方法和静态方法(JDK8) 3. 私有方法(JDK9) 重点 :静态私有方法,解决多个静态方法之间重复 ...
分类:编程语言   时间:2020-03-04 00:26:47    阅读次数:89
2552条   上一页 1 ... 21 22 23 24 25 ... 256 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!